Newcastle United showcased fighting spirit during the absence of Isak

  • Newcastle United demonstrated fighting spirit during the match against Liverpool.
  • The team lost important players, but managed to gather and fight.
  • The absence of Isak negatively impacted the team's results.

Newcastle United faced a crucial match against Liverpool, in which they felt the absence of their attacking player Alexander Isak. At the start of the season, the team had already lost many opportunities, including in the last two matches, where they only managed to gain one point.

The match began with heightened tension, as Newcastle fans actively supported their team, displaying banners that emphasized unity. The players responded to this support, but unfortunately after the start, they received a blow: Antonin Gordan was sent off the field, which complicated the situation for the team.

Following the red card, Newcastle demonstrated fighting spirit. Bruno Guimaraes scored to level the match, but in the final moments of the match, Liverpool gained the lead thanks to a header from Rio Nguumokhi.

The absence of Isak, who is trying to convince the club to let him leave for Liverpool, negatively impacted the team. Some fans express dissatisfaction with his behavior, believing that his absence reflects on the results. Regardless of this, the team continues to fight, demonstrating a high level of unity and resilience.
